THE ULTIMATE WEB SOLUTIONS MANUAL: EVERY LITTLE THING YOU NEED TO KNOW

The Ultimate Web Solutions Manual: Every Little Thing You Need To Know

The Ultimate Web Solutions Manual: Every Little Thing You Need To Know

Blog Article

Material Develop By-Cotton North

Discover the utmost Internet Providers Manual for all your demands. Explore interaction procedures, core concepts of SOAP and REST, and finest practices for seamless application. Discover the secrets to understanding internet services, from recognizing the essentials to carrying out scalable architecture. Master the art of developing safe systems and optimizing for future growth. https://smallbusinessseoservices40628.bloggerbags.com/31704733/wanting-to-increase-your-website-s-presence-and-ranking-on-search-engines-learn-how-to-kickstart-your-internet-site-s-seo-success-today of internet services within your reaches.

Summary of Web Solutions



If you've ever before wondered what web services are and how they work, this introduction is the best area to start. Web services are a way for different applications to communicate with each other online. They permit seamless assimilation of systems, making it much easier to share information and functionalities.

Among the vital elements of internet services is their use of common protocols like HTTP and XML to facilitate communication. This standardization ensures that various systems can comprehend and connect with each other successfully. Web solutions can be categorized right into two primary types: SOAP (Simple Item Accessibility Procedure) and REST (Representational State Transfer).

SOAP is a procedure that utilizes XML for message exchange, while remainder relies upon typical HTTP techniques like obtain, PUBLISH, PUT, and erase. Both have their toughness and are utilized in various scenarios based upon needs.

Secret Concepts and Technologies



Discovering the fundamental ideas and modern technologies of web solutions is vital for comprehending their performance and application in contemporary systems. When diving into the key concepts and modern technologies of internet services, you unlock to a globe of interconnected opportunities. Here are some essential elements to realize:

- ** SOAP (Simple Things Accessibility Procedure) **: This method defines the structure of messages traded between internet solutions.
- ** WSDL (Web Providers Summary Language) **: WSDL is utilized to describe the performances used by a web solution.
- ** REST (Representational State Transfer) **: An architectural design that utilizes basic HTTP methods for communication in between customers and servers.
- ** XML (Extensible Markup Language) **: XML plays an important function in information exchange between web solutions because of its flexibility and readability.

Recognizing these core concepts and modern technologies will certainly lay a strong foundation for your journey into the realm of internet solutions.

Best Practices for Implementation



To make sure effective implementation of internet services, focus on adherence to ideal methods. Begin by extensively documenting seo search engine results , including clear summaries of endpoints, specifications, and anticipated feedbacks. Consistent naming conventions and versioning of APIs are essential for maintainability. When creating your internet solutions, adhere to the principles of remainder to develop a scalable and flexible architecture. Execute appropriate verification and authorization systems to safeguard your solutions, such as OAuth or API secrets.

Checking is crucial in ensuring the integrity of your web solutions. Develop comprehensive test cases that cover various situations, consisting of favorable and negative testing. Constant assimilation and automated testing can assist catch issues early in the development process. Monitor your internet services in real-time to recognize efficiency bottlenecks and possible failures. Logging and error handling are necessary for identifying problems and repairing troubles properly.



Lastly, think about the scalability of your internet solutions deliberately for future growth. Implement caching systems and lots harmonizing to take care of increased traffic. Routinely review and optimize your code for effectiveness. By complying with these best methods, you can simplify the execution of web services and ensure their success.

Final thought

Congratulations! You have actually just opened the key to grasping web services. By recognizing the vital concepts and technologies, and executing ideal practices, you're well on your method to coming to be an internet services expert.

Keep checking out and experimenting with what you have actually learned to continue expanding your knowledge and abilities in this exciting field.

The globe of web services is currently within your reaches, ready for you to discover and conquer. Appreciate the trip!